Personal & Financial Insights

Every occupation has a unique profile. For Chief Executives, the Bureau of Labor Statistics and O*NET classify the day-to-day work broadly as: Determine and formulate policies and provide overall direction of companies or private and public sector organizations within guidelines set up by a board of directors or similar governing body. Plan, direct, or coordinate operational activities at the highest level of management with the help of subordinate executives and staff managers.

Avg. Annual Salary $262,930
Avg. Hourly Wage $126.41
Available Jobs (US) 211,850
Job Title & Hierarchy Code (SOC) Chief Executives #11-1011

Core Skills & Abilities

  • Refer major policy matters to elected representatives for final decisions.

  • Direct or conduct studies or research on issues affecting areas of responsibility.

  • Nominate citizens to boards or commissions.

  • Deliver speeches, write articles, or present information at meetings or conventions to promote services, exchange ideas, or accomplish objectives.

  • Prepare budgets for approval, including those for funding or implementation of programs.

  • Direct human resources activities, including the approval of human resource plans or activities, the selection of directors or other high-level staff, or establishment or organization of major departments.

  • Review and analyze legislation, laws, or public policy and recommend changes to promote or support interests of the general population or special groups.

  • Make presentations to legislative or other government committees regarding policies, programs, or budgets.

  • Preside over, or serve on, boards of directors, management committees, or other governing boards.

  • Negotiate or approve contracts or agreements with suppliers, distributors, federal or state agencies, or other organizational entities.

  • Prepare or present reports concerning activities, expenses, budgets, government statutes or rulings, or other items affecting businesses or program services.

  • Direct non-merchandising departments, such as advertising, purchasing, credit, or accounting.

  • Conduct or direct investigations or hearings to resolve complaints or violations of laws, or testify at such hearings.

  • Coordinate the development or implementation of budgetary control systems, recordkeeping systems, or other administrative control processes.

  • Review reports submitted by staff members to recommend approval or to suggest changes.

  • Appoint department heads or managers and assign or delegate responsibilities to them.

  • Attend and participate in meetings of municipal councils or council committees.

  • Direct or coordinate an organization's financial or budget activities to fund operations, maximize investments, or increase efficiency.

  • Represent organizations or promote their objectives at official functions, or delegate representatives to do so.

  • Implement corrective action plans to solve organizational or departmental problems.

  • Serve as liaisons between organizations, shareholders, and outside organizations.

  • Prepare bylaws approved by elected officials, and ensure that bylaws are enforced.

  • Analyze operations to evaluate performance of a company or its staff in meeting objectives or to determine areas of potential cost reduction, program improvement, or policy change.

  • Establish departmental responsibilities and coordinate functions among departments and sites.

  • Direct or coordinate activities of businesses or departments concerned with production, pricing, sales, or distribution of products.

  • Direct, plan, or implement policies, objectives, or activities of organizations or businesses to ensure continuing operations, to maximize returns on investments, or to increase productivity.

  • Direct or coordinate activities of businesses involved with buying or selling investment products or financial services.

  • Organize or approve promotional campaigns.

  • Administer programs for selection of sites, construction of buildings, or provision of equipment or supplies.

  • Confer with board members, organization officials, or staff members to discuss issues, coordinate activities, or resolve problems.

  • Interpret and explain policies, rules, regulations, or laws to organizations, government or corporate officials, or individuals.
